Form the habit of formulating questions.Do I agree with this?Is this like something I have experienced myself?Why has the writer used this particular word?相当聪明的苍蝇解读The Fairly Intelligent FlyA large spider in an old house built a beautiful web in which to catch flies. Every

7、time a fly landed on the web and was entangled in it the spider devoured him, so that when another fly came along he would think the web was a safe and quiet place in which to rest. One day a fairly intelligent fly buzzed around above the web so long before alighting that the spider appeared and sai

8、d, Come on down. But the fly was too clever for him and said, I never light where I dont see other flies and I dont see any other flies in your house. So he flew away until he came to a place where there were a great many other flies. He was about to settle down among them when a bee buzzed up and s

9、aid, Hold it, stupid, thats flypaper. All those flies are trapped. Dont be silly, said the fly, theyre dancing. So he settled down and became stuck to the flypaper with all the other flies.Moral: There is no safety in numbers, or in anything else.TasksT1. The writer uses the word devoured. Why do yo

10、u think he preferred this word to any of the following equivalents? ate, consumed, gobbled up , swallowed.FEEDBACKAte is a very general word, so it is not precise enough. Consumed is also not really appropriate; it does not suggest the physical act of eating.Swallowed is physical but it does not sug

11、gest a violent form of eating. Gobbled up would be possible. It indicates greed and voracious hunger. But best of all is devoured, which has connotations of greed, of monsters tearing bodies apart, of rapaciousness, of eating something completely.T2. Look at the word entangled. Can you find three wo

12、rds the writer uses to mean roughly the same thing?FEEDBACKtrapped; catch; stuck.T3. The writer uses the word landed. How many other words does the writer use to convey roughly the same meaning? FEEDBACKalighting; light; settle down; (and possibly rest.)削皮刀解读A Paring KnifePlot summaryIn the first pa
